Camera
“
Camera
”
on the menu bar provides options to manage the camera. One can
“
Add
”
additional Camera with a maximum of 16 Camera allowed for viewing. Through the
management function one can
“
Delete
”
a camera, manage the
“
Property
”
,
“
Enable
”
for real time and take a
“
Snap shot
”
image. The menu bar is illustrated below:
Figure 5-4: Camera Screen
By default the video image is enabled. There will be a
“
check
”
next to the
Enable
command to show that the Enable function is working. To disable real-time image
select
“
Camera
”
>
“
Enable
”
and real-time video image will stop and shutdown.
Once you select
“
Motion Active Mode
”
of a specific camera, the
“
Enable Motion
”
option will add to the drop-down list as below.
Figure 5-5: Camera Screen in Motion Active Mode
